What Wisconsin Employers Look For

The qualifications that appear most often in talent specialist jobs across Wisconsin.

  • Bachelor's degree in human resources, business, or a related field required
  • Two or more years of full-cycle recruiting or talent acquisition experience preferred
  • Proficiency with applicant tracking systems such as Workday or iCIMS
  • Strong sourcing skills using professional networks, job boards, and talent pipelines
  • Experience partnering with hiring managers to define role requirements and close candidates
  • PHR or SHRM-CP certification viewed favorably by most Wisconsin employers

How do you become a talent specialist in Wisconsin?

Most talent specialist roles in Wisconsin require a bachelor's degree in human resources, business administration, or a related field. Wisconsin does not issue a state-specific license for talent specialists, but earning a nationally recognized credential such as the SHRM-CP or PHR strengthens your candidacy significantly. Employers in the state, particularly in healthcare and manufacturing, also place weight on hands-on recruiting experience gained through internships or HR coordinator roles.

Are there remote talent specialist jobs in Wisconsin?

Yes, and more than many fields, since talent specialist work is largely desk-based and communication-driven. About 40% of talent specialist openings tied to Wisconsin are remote or hybrid as of August 2026, reflecting how well the role adapts to distributed work. Sourcing, candidate screening, and coordination tasks are the functions most commonly performed fully remotely, while final interviews and onboarding support often require at least occasional on-site presence.

How can I get hired as a talent specialist in Wisconsin with little or no experience?

The most realistic entry path is an HR coordinator or recruiting coordinator role, which many large Wisconsin employers use as a direct pipeline into talent acquisition. Advocate Aurora Health, American Family Insurance, and the UW System all post early-career HR roles that provide hands-on recruiting exposure. Completing a SHRM student membership or a PHR exam preparation course while in that first role signals commitment and speeds up the transition to a full talent specialist title.
